The player with Zimbabwean roots has scored an impressive 15 goals in 27 appearances across all competitions this season.

South African Premier Soccer League side Marumo Gallants look to have resigned themselves to the possibility of losing experienced goal poacher Ranga Chivaviro during the upcoming transfer window.

Chivaviro has been a standout performer for the Bahlabane ba Ntwa and won himself plenty of admirers for his performances in the current CAF Confederation Cup season.

Among them are Tanzania Premier League moneybags Azam FC who are believed to have already started talks over a possible move from Limpopo to Dar es Salaam for the 30-year-old.

"Chivaviro is a player who has an excellent final touch. There is a possibility that he will be coming to Tanzania to link up with Azam," said a source.

Simba SC and Yanga have also entered the race, according to the player's agent Herve Tra Bi as per the South African publication KickOff.

"We are receiving interest both from local and international teams," said Bi. "There is also interest from Saudi Arabia, but unfortunately, I can't reveal their names. 

"His contract with Marumo Gallants is set to expire next month. But he has an option [of an extra year]. We still have to discuss that with Marumo Gallants at the end of the season.

"The club has been good to the player, and everything has to be handled in a more professional manner if he has to leave the club at the end of the season."

Chivaviro has been in scintillating form for Marumo this season, as he has netted 10 goals in the South Africa Premier Soccer League and five in the CAF Confederations Cup.

The striker joined Marumo on a one-year deal with an option to extend his stay for another year, and Marumo are reported to have made their intentions known to Chivaviro that they intend to trigger that option.
